i was at a friend's house the other day & we were discussing my diva cup. i mentioned that you typically empty it out into the toilet & rinse in the sink, which he thought was sort of gross (the whole "period residue in the sink" thing). he thought that it would be better to rinse off in the shower.

so my question is: when the time comes to empty your cup & you happen to be at someone else's house, do you go ahead & rinse it in the sink, or would you just clean with toilet paper (as though you were in a public restroom) or rinse in the shower?

Depending on the bathroom layout... I would not think twice about emptying my cup in the toilet then rinsing in the sink. It's what I do at home, and I would be kind of curious if someone used the toilet in our house but I then heard the shower running.

That said, I know my bathroom back home in Australia has the toilet separated from the bathroom and its sink, as do other friends' houses here - in that case, I'd empty the cup in the toilet and give it a bit of a wipe down with toilet paper, then wash it with hot water next chance I got. (In the shower if I'm home.)
